English Teacher – Full-Time, Permanent
Location:
Tamworth (B79)
Salary : £32,433 – £42,352 per year
We are seeking a dedicated and skilled English Teacher to join a supportive secondary school catering to students aged 11–18 with SEMH (Social, Emotional, and Mental Health) needs. This is a full-time, permanent position offering the opportunity to make a meaningful difference in students’ lives.
About the School and Students- Small class sizes – Work closely with up to 21 students, providing personalised attention and support.
- Tailored learning – Deliver GCSE and Functional Skills English lessons, adapted to individual student needs.
- Trauma-informed approach – Employ PACE, emotion coaching, and restorative practices to support pupils in managing emotions and achieving academic success.
- Holistic development – Help students build confidence, resilience, and life skills while preparing them for adulthood.
- Professional growth – Join a collaborative team with opportunities for ongoing training and career development.
- Plan and deliver engaging English lessons in line with students’ personalised outcomes.
- Support pupils in achieving GCSE and Functional Skills qualifications.
- Contribute to EHCP (Education, Health, and Care Plan) reviews and meetings.
- Promote positive relationships with students, parents, carers, and other professionals.
- Embed social, moral, spiritual, and cultural learning opportunities within lessons.
- Complete mandatory safeguarding and professional development training.
- Qualified Teacher Status (QTS)
- Current DBS check
- Strong communication skills
- Experience working with vulnerable or SEMH students
- Emotional intelligence, resilience, and adaptability
- Ability to work effectively both independently and within a team
- Recent experience teaching in a SEND or SEMH setting
- Knowledge of EHCP implementation and SEND legislation
This role offers the chance to make a real impact, supporting students who have faced challenges affecting their learning. You will help them achieve academic success while fostering personal growth, confidence, and resilience
